📋 About This Mod

The official reshade of Tales of Night City.

This is the official reshade of Tales of Night City, a mod collection with 1000+ mods, for game version 2. 31a, that I've been working on since 2. 12a.

This reshade is created with Nova LUT 3 in mind, however it is not a requirement. Do note however, that the collection is using several visual mods to achieve these types of visuals. If you plan on using it outside of the collection, your experience may vary quite a bit.

You need Reshade 6. 6. 2+

You need the "XRF_LUT3.png" from the "reshade-shaders/Textures/" folder -- without this LUT, it won't look even close; what this is, is a hyper optimized LUT I've been working on since I've made my original reshade for Baldur's Gate 3 back on it's release; it's essentially doubling as a reshade preset on it's own.

The archive only contains the preset as well as the LUT file, place "XRF ToNC.ini" and "reshade-shaders" folder into the following folder structure:

"Cyberpunk 2077\bin\x64\" -- I'm on GoG, but I expect Steam version to be similar, just make sure it's in "\bin\x64\"; this is also where your .exe is located for the Reshade installation, which you will have to do prior to booting your game. You can install all shaders or select "XRF ToNC.ini" during install and it will only install those specific shaders, the choices is yours.

Depending on your screen's contrast, gamma, brightness, peak whites and black levels, you might have to do some adjustments on your own. Please make sure you calibrate your in-game gamma after applying the reshade. In-game, ideally you'd only have to touch HDR power, but again, it's very much depending on your screen's calibration and capabilities as well.

In-game instructions:

Turn off reshade initially, start a save, turn on reshade and follow bellow instructions and let it calibrate for a couple of seconds.

RT_Correct_Constrast.fx -> Freeze Correction (tick off then back on, it can cause issues if it's on from the start); alternatively you can leave Freeze Correction off, but it'll constantly re-calibrate.
